Related Product Features:
Composed of doped silicates with a green powder appearance and a density of 4.8 g/cm3.
Features a peak wavelength of 520±2.0nm and precise chromaticity coordinates (x=0.2490±0.003, y=0.6461±0.003) for pure color output.
Designed with a controlled particle size of D50=15±2.0μm for excellent dispersion in encapsulation materials.
Efficiently absorbs blue light chips in the 445~465nm range, maximizing light conversion and luminous efficacy.
Exhibits high stability with minimal light decay (under 5%) after 2000 hours at 85°C/85% RH.
Lead-free and RoHS compliant, ensuring safety and environmental friendliness.
Suitable for various applications including automotive lighting, medical equipment, and decorative lighting.
Offers high luminous efficiency of 134Lm/W and consistent color performance across batches.
FAQs:
What is the model number and composition of this phosphor?
The model number is SDS520, and it is composed of doped silicates (M2SiO4:Eu2+ where M=Ca,Sr,Ba), appearing as a green powder.
How does this phosphor perform under high-temperature and high-humidity conditions?
It exhibits strong stability, with light decay controlled within 5% after 2000 hours of continuous operation at 85°C and 85% relative humidity, ensuring long service life.
What are the key optical characteristics and applications of the SDS520 phosphor?
It has a peak wavelength of 520±2.0nm, high luminous efficiency, and is used in automotive lighting, medical devices, and decorative lighting for clear, consistent color output.
Is this product compliant with environmental and safety standards?
Yes, it is lead-free and fully RoHS compliant, meeting CE certification requirements for safe use in various applications.
